Centre County proclaims April as Employee Appreciation and Justice Education Month
Summary
The Centre County Board of Commissioners adopted two proclamations recognizing April 2025 as National County Government and Centre County Employee Appreciation Month and as Justice Education Month; Penn State presenters outlined events and reentry programs associated with Justice Education Month.

The Centre County Board of Commissioners voted unanimously March 28 to adopt two proclamations: proclamation No. 11 of 2025, recognizing April 2025 as National County Government and Centre County Employee Appreciation Month, and proclamation No. 12 of 2025, recognizing April 2025 as Justice Education Month in Centre County.
Brandy Henry of the Penn State College of Education Restorative Justice Institute outlined a monthlong slate of events tied to Justice Education Month, including a March 28 presentation by two justice-impacted graduate students; a panel on Penn State’s prison-education history; an interactive reentry simulation at Dickinson Law School in Carlisle; a two-day restorative circles and conferencing training; movie screenings and panel discussions; and a keynote by Doshna Polanco (as announced). Henry said events will be held on campus with Zoom options and posted on the institute’s website.
Commissioner Concepcion and other commissioners thanked Penn State staff and county employees, noting the county’s collaboration with courts, probation and specialty courts and highlighting efforts to reduce the jail population through treatment and reentry programs. The board invited members of the public and county staff to attend events and to use outreach material that will be distributed through county communications.
The board adopted both proclamations by voice vote; the minutes record “aye” votes with no opposition.
